This pull request introduces a new "strict mode" for the CLI tools (arkor init and create-arkor) when running under the CLAUDECODE=1 environment variable, which is used by Claude Code (Anthropic's agent CLI). In this mode, all flags that correspond to interactive prompts must be explicitly provided, preventing the CLI from silently accepting defaults or hanging on prompts that can't be answered. The documentation, tests, and environment setup have been updated to support and document this behavior.

Key changes:

Strict Mode for Claude Code (CLAUDECODE=1):

  • Added strict mode to arkor init and create-arkor that requires all interactive-equivalent flags to be explicitly set when CLAUDECODE=1, exiting early with a detailed message if any are missing. This prevents silent or unintended project scaffolding by AI agents. [1] [2] [3]

  • The missing flag message includes a one-line description for each required flag, making it easy for agents or users to decide on values without consulting the documentation. [1] [2]

  • For create-arkor, the project name ([dir] or --name) is also required in strict mode to avoid generic defaults.

Testing and Environment Handling:

  • Added comprehensive E2E and unit tests for strict mode, verifying early exits, correct messaging, and that no files are created if required flags are missing. Tests also verify that passing --yes opts out of strict mode, restoring legacy default-acceptance behavior. [1] [2]

  • Updated test and spawn environments to clear CLAUDECODE by default, ensuring that strict mode is only enabled in tests that explicitly opt in. This prevents unrelated tests from failing due to inherited environment variables. [1] [2] [3] [4] [5] [6] [7] [8] [9] [10] [11] [12]

Documentation Updates:

  • Added English and Japanese documentation explaining strict mode, required flags, sample error output, and rationale for the behavior under CLAUDECODE=1. [1] [2]

P2 Badge Resolve [dir] before validating strict project-name

hasMeaningfulProjectName() derives [dir] with basename(opts.dir), which treats inputs like . or foo/.. as ./.. and then collapses them to the arkor-project fallback. Under CLAUDECODE=1, this incorrectly reports [dir] as missing even when the invocation is fully explicit (for example create-arkor . --template ...), causing an early exit in strict mode. The scaffold path/name logic in create-arkor normalizes with resolve() first, so strict validation should mirror that normalization to avoid false failures.

P2 Badge Accept explicit names that sanitize to arkor-project

hasMeaningfulProjectName() only treats arkor-project as explicit when the raw input is exactly that string after trim/lowercase, so strict mode rejects explicit values like --name "Arkor Project" or a [dir] basename like Arkor_Project even though those are deliberate inputs and the scaffolder would proceed with that sanitized name. Under CLAUDECODE=1, this causes a false "missing [dir]/--name" exit for otherwise fully-specified commands.

### Running under Claude Code (`CLAUDECODE=1`)

Claude Code spawns child processes with `CLAUDECODE=1`, and it cannot answer interactive prompts. To prevent the agent from silently scaffolding with hidden defaults, `create-arkor` flips into a strict mode under this env var: every flag that mirrors an interactive prompt becomes required, and a missing one produces a stderr message listing the suggested re-invocation rather than running. The same rule applies to [`arkor init`](/cli/init#claude-code-claudecode-1-strict-mode), with one extra requirement here: `[dir]` (or `--name`) is also mandatory, since the default fallback (`arkor-project`) is almost always an oversight rather than an intentional choice. Empty / whitespace-only / punctuation-only values that `sanitise()` would collapse back to that fallback are also rejected.
